PROFESSIONAL boxing returns to Frome after two years with local boxer, Ryan Wheeler, taking on Spain’s Jose Ramos Savin, on Friday 19th July.
Two undefeated fighters go head to head in a bout that brings boxing home to Frome at the Cheese and Grain.
Ryan ‘The Somerset Stallion’ Wheeler will put on a show for the home crowds, looking for his 16th win whilst aiming for his first knockout.
Jose Ramos Savin from Spain is coming to Frome off a draw against fellow Spaniard Antonio Rodriguez but is also hungry for his fifth win.
Ryan Wheeler said, “This is my toughest fight yet against another undefeated fighter. It’s two years since I last boxed in Frome and the atmosphere was incredible. I have always dreamed of boxing in my hometown and I now have the chance to do it again! I would love to have as much support as possible.”
The undercard also promises big blows as Anton Haskins of Bristol makes his pro debut against Aaron Sutton of Bristol.
